13 Example Sentences Showcasing the Meaning of 'Approbative'

The scientist received approbative reviews for the groundbreaking research that could revolutionize the field of medicine.

The CEO expressed an approbative attitude towards the innovative ideas presented by the research and development team.

The project manager received an approbative nod from the client, signifying approval of the project plan and timeline.

The novelist felt a sense of accomplishment when she received an approbative letter from a renowned literary critic.

The community leaders were approbative of the environmentally friendly initiatives, applauding efforts to promote sustainability.

The software developer earned an approbative nod from the team for writing efficient and bug-free code during the project.

The mentor provided approbative guidance to the protege, recognizing their potential for growth in the field of engineering.

The philanthropist received approbative accolades for their generous contributions, positively impacting various charitable causes.

The judge delivered an approbative verdict, praising the lawyer's meticulous presentation of evidence during the high-profile trial.

The art curator offered an approbative commentary on the intricate details and symbolism in the painter's latest masterpiece.

The political leader received an approbative endorsement from influential figures in the party, solidifying her candidacy for the upcoming election.

The fashion designer received approbative acclaim for her innovative and trend-setting collection showcased at the international fashion show.

The historian's approbative analysis of the documentary highlighted its accuracy and comprehensive coverage of historical events.
